The full picture

FCN Banc Corp. is a small regional bank holding company based in the United States. It offers everyday banking services like checking and savings accounts, loans, and mortgages, mainly to individuals and small businesses in its local communities. Regional banks like this one compete by building close relationships with customers in areas that larger national banks sometimes overlook.

The company makes money primarily through the difference between the interest it charges on loans and the interest it pays on deposits, known as net interest income. With a market cap of around $100 million, it is a very small bank with operations concentrated in a limited geographic area, which means its fortunes are closely tied to the health of its local economy. The main risk it faces is rising interest rates or a slowdown in its region, either of which can squeeze profit margins and increase loan defaults.
